UK and Germany sign major contract for next-generation bridging equipment
A landmark reciprocal procurement contract between the United Kingdom and Germany will deliver next-generation battlefield mobility to the British Army while creating a significant export opportunity for the UK defence supply chain. The agreement, managed by the Organisation for Joint Armament Cooperation (OCCAR), reinforces the deepening industrial and military partnership established under the Trinity House and Kensington Agreements.
